The duty of the CFO is among the most elderly within the finance division. The CFO looks after the entire financing function, with a level or pyramid structure that allows the CFO to manage numerous employees. While not involved in day-to-day accounting, the CFO is accountable for the exact prep work and also review of the firm's economic statements. Inevitably, the CFO gives the chief executive officer with monetary recommendations as well as support.

Monetary analysis as well as projecting are two of the most important functions of a CFO. They utilize historical data to establish estimates of future monetary outcomes and also assign sources as necessary. Financial reporting helps interior as well as outside stakeholders understand the health and wellness of the business. Inevitably, CFOs have to certify financial statements are accurate as well as full. These functions make the CFO necessary for any organization. They play a vital function in keeping the company on track and also fulfilling its goals.

A CFO dashboard should also consist of a company's gross profit margin, which is an essential statistics for the financing department. This metric procedures the success of a company by subtracting prices for products marketed from earnings. It is revealed as a percent of earnings, and rising and fall profits are a clear indicator of bad administration. A rising and fall gross profit margin is a red flag and ought to be resolved promptly. Besides being a crucial metric, it is an useful indicator of the wellness of the firm's financial resources.

Financial projecting is among the most crucial functions of a CFO. A CFO needs to have the capacity to forecast future outcomes by assessing both interior and external variables. They have to create earnings projections for the CEO, along with departmental projections. The inner aspects include sales fads as well as labor costs, while external aspects include emerging competitors and breakthroughs in innovation. The CFO's work is to provide one of the most precise economic statements.

The CFO likewise manages the resources structure of a business. He or she requires to determine the very best mix of equity, debt, and interior financing. The CFO additionally needs to track the monetary health and wellness of the business as well as keep track of any type of modifications that can affect it. In addition to these functions, a CFO is additionally in charge of the company's total efficiency. The CFO reports to the board on the monetary wellness of the firm.

While CFOs might be interested in consumer repayments, regulating expenditures, and conference financial obligations, they are likewise worried about making sure that their companies have a solid return on investment (ROI). A roi (ROI) measures whether a job is most likely to produce a revenue or loss, and it tries to calculate this in specific terms. The ROI, nonetheless, does not account for all variables as well as needs the CFO to include context to establish the ROI of a job.
